The CARSPA UPS600 inverter is a 3-in-1 device: inverter + UPS + charger. It can be used as a backup power source for appliances, particularly computers, data equipment and other sensitive devices, in the event of a power cut.
In normal operation, equipment is powered directly from the mains. In the event of an interruption, the inverter switches over in just 8 ms and begins converting the voltage from the 12V DC battery to 230V AC, ensuring continuous operation. When mains power is restored, the power supply switches back to the mains, and the inverter automatically starts the process of charging the backup battery.
It also features a 5V / 2.1A USB port for charging mobile devices.
⚠️ Note: not recommended for equipment with asynchronous motors or other rotating machinery.

The Victron Cerbo GX MK2 is an advanced communications hub that allows you to fully control and maximise the performance of your system wherever you are. It can connect via Bluetooth to the VictronConnect app or via Wi-Fi using the VRM portal, offering intuitive monitoring and control for all Victron products, such as inverters, MPPT solar chargers, and battery monitors.
Differences from the Cerbo GX:
Two fully functional VE.Can ports (isolated), compared to a single VE.Can port and one BMS-Can port on previous models.
All three USB ports are fully functional.
The RJ-45 connections are rotated by 180° for easier access.
Digital inputs can count pulses.
Connections and Features:
Bluetooth for connection via the VictronConnect app.
Wi-Fi for access to the VRM portal.
NMEA 2000 output for integration into marine networks.
Remote monitoring and control via the VRM Console, including on local area networks (LAN).
Optimised Performance: The Cerbo GX MK2 maximises the performance of system components in real time, supporting lithium battery management and control of up to 25 VE.Can solar chargers simultaneously. It can monitor 4 tanks, 4 temperature ports and includes multiple communication ports for expanded control.
Ports and Connections:
3 VE.Direct ports, 2 VE.Can ports, 2 BMS-CAN ports, 2 VE.Bus ports, 3 USB ports, Ethernet socket, WiFi, Bluetooth, SD card and inputs for 4 temperature sensors and 4 tank sensors.
Third-party compatibility: The Cerbo GX MK2 can communicate with third-party products using Modbus-TCP protocols and the VRM JSON API.
Easy Installation and Configuration: The Cerbo GX MK2 is easy to install and configure, making it ideal for a variety of power supply applications.

SUN-100K-SG02HP3-EU-GM10 is a 100kW three-phase hybrid inverter designed for commercial and industrial photovoltaic systems that require intelligent energy generation, storage and management.
The inverter can be integrated into production facilities, warehouses, farms, commercial buildings, logistics centres and other installations with high energy consumption.
High power for commercial and industrial applications
The inverter delivers a rated AC active power of 100kW and supports a maximum PV input power of 160kW. Its maximum AC input/output apparent power is 110kVA.
In off-grid mode, the inverter can deliver a peak power equal to 1.5 times its rated power for 10 seconds. This capacity helps supply equipment with high start-up currents.
10 MPPT trackers
The model is equipped with 10 MPPT trackers and two string inputs for each MPPT.
This configuration allows multiple groups of solar panels to be connected and provides greater flexibility for installations with different panel orientations, tilt angles or lighting conditions. The MPPT operating range is 150–850VDC, while the maximum permitted PV input voltage is 1000VDC.
High-voltage batteries
The inverter is compatible with high-voltage lithium-ion batteries operating within a voltage range of 160–1000VDC.
The two independent battery inputs allow a total maximum charging and discharging current of 200A. The charging strategy automatically adapts based on communication with the battery management system.
Using a high-voltage architecture helps reduce system currents and achieve high efficiency in high-power installations.
On-grid and off-grid operation
The SUN-100K-SG02HP3-EU-GM10 can operate both connected to the utility grid and in off-grid applications.
The AC coupling function allows the inverter to be integrated into an existing photovoltaic installation and upgraded with an energy storage system.
The inverter provides six programmable time periods for battery charging and discharging. Energy can be managed according to consumption, photovoltaic production, grid availability and electricity tariff periods.
The equipment also supports storing energy supplied by a diesel generator.
Modular system expansion
For projects requiring higher power, up to 10 inverters can be connected in parallel for both on-grid and off-grid operation.
The system also supports multiple batteries connected in parallel. This configuration enables modular installations that can be expanded as energy consumption increases.
High efficiency
The inverter achieves:
maximum efficiency of 98.7%;
European efficiency of 98.1%;
MPPT efficiency above 99%.
The intelligent air-cooling system adjusts its operation according to the inverter temperature and load.
Monitoring and communication
Operating information is displayed through the LCD screen and LED indicators.
The inverter features RS485, RS232 and CAN communication interfaces. Depending on the accessories used, monitoring can be performed via Wi-Fi, Bluetooth, GPRS, 4G or LAN.
Integrated protection features
The inverter includes:
DC reverse-polarity protection;
AC output overcurrent protection;
thermal protection;
AC output overvoltage protection;
AC output short-circuit protection;
DC component monitoring;
anti-islanding protection;
DC switch;
insulation impedance detection;
residual current detection;
Type II surge protection on both the DC and AC sides;
optional AFCI protection.
The IP65-rated enclosure protects the equipment against dust and water jets. The operating temperature range is −40°C to +60°C, with power derating above 45°C.
